Proposal
Part single storey, part two storey rear extension with ground floor canopy, two side windows and rear patio.
As published by the council, reference 23/03915/HOU

About householder applications
Householder applications cover work to an existing house and its garden, such as extensions, lofts and outbuildings, and cannot create a separate dwelling or change what the building is used for. More in our guide to planning application types.
